Bottom line is that you NEED to be able to know what SG your tank is at. You just throwing random amounts of salt in the tank is an awful idea. You also need a liquid test kit for ammonia. You could be throwing too much salt in there which will kill all your good bacteria causing a cycle and high ammonia levels. Which is a very bad thing for your puff. Have you been doing water changes to see if it perks him up at all? If you want to be a responsible fish keeper you'll get either a hydrometer or refractometer that starts St 1.000 and ammonia test .
